Sutton House, built in 1535 by prominent courtier of Henry VIII, Sir Ralph Sadleir, retains much of the atmosphere of a Tudor home despite some alterations by later occupants, including a succession of merchants, Huguenot silkweavers, and squatters. Discover oak-panelled rooms, original carved fireplaces and a charming courtyard, all in the heart of East London.
